Mechanical Superintendent
PCL Construction · Richmond
Job description
About the role
As a Mechanical Superintendent with PCL Constructors Westcoast Inc., you will lead mechanical construction activities on legacy projects across British Columbia. You will work closely with the project manager and field teams to ensure safety, quality, and schedule objectives are met while fostering a collaborative work environment.
Key responsibilities
- Work with the project manager to implement PCL’s safety program and ensure compliance with all safety and record‑keeping requirements.
- Supervise, direct, coach, train and mentor the project team, including both direct and indirect reports.
- Communicate effectively with trades and forces to meet performance, productivity, quality and safety targets.
- Collaborate with the construction/project manager and project team to proactively manage problems, work interferences and schedule conflicts.
- Liaise between field engineers, estimators and subcontractors to ensure construction complies with drawings and specifications.
- Coordinate with client, other site contractors, union and labour relations, and site and office representatives.
- Visualize the entire project, develop the complete project schedule, identify the critical path and anticipate constructability issues.
- Develop and implement the Project Execution Plan (PEP) and resource‑loaded three‑week look‑ahead schedules.
Required profile
- Proven experience supervising mechanical construction projects.
- Strong knowledge of safety regulations and ability to enforce safety programs.
- Excellent leadership and team‑building abilities.
- Effective communication and problem‑solving skills.
- Ability to read and interpret construction drawings and specifications.
- Experience coordinating with clients, unions and multiple stakeholders.
